Boundary-Value Problems for Gravimetric Determination of a Precise Geoid

This text offers simultaneous treatment of the theory and numerical applications of boundary-value problems related to the determination of a precise geoid from gravimetric data. The following subjects are discussed: topographical effects and their computations in precise gravimetric geoid determination; the downward continuation of a harmonic function; Stokes' problem formulated with ellipsoid of revolution; spherical Stokes' problem with ellipsoidal corrections involved in boundary conditions for an anomalous potential; and the altimetry-gravimetry boundary-value problem. Answers to a number of scientific problems, raised and discussed in geodetic literature, can be found here. The book is intended for scientists and advanced graduate students.
